Introduction to roulette

Roulette is one of the most popular and iconic casino games, known for its simplicity, elegance, and excitement. Originating in 18th-century France, the name "roulette" translates to "little wheel" in French, reflecting the game's primary focus. The objective of roulette is straightforward: players place bets on where a small ball will land after being spun around a numbered wheel. The wheel consists of either 37 or 38 pockets, depending on whether it's European or American roulette, and each pocket is numbered from 0 to 36, with alternating red and black colors, and sometimes an additional green "0" or "00."

The Origins of roulette: A Historical Journey

Roulette, a staple in the world of casino games, has a fascinating history that traces back to 18th-century France. The game’s name, derived from the French word for "little wheel," reflects its central feature. The earliest version of roulette can be attributed to the French inventor Blaise Pascal, who, in his quest to create a perpetual motion machine, inadvertently developed a rudimentary form of the game. By the late 18th century, roulette had evolved into a popular gambling game in French casinos, complete with the iconic wheel and betting layout that players recognize today.

The game's spread to other parts of Europe and beyond occurred in the 19th century, with notable adaptations and variations. When roulette reached the United States, American casinos introduced an additional "00" pocket on the wheel, creating what is now known as American Roulette. This adjustment increased the house edge compared to the European version, which features only a single "0" pocket. Despite this difference, both versions retained the core appeal of roulette: a blend of chance and strategy combined with the excitement of watching the wheel spin.
